All of you aspiring pirates Blu-ray enthusiasts have reason to get excited as Pioneer has recently unveiled their latest Blu-ray burner, the BDR-S03J.

While only available in Japan starting in January, the BDR-S03J features the ability to burn single, as well as dual, layer Blu-rays at a speed of 8x. Of course, it can also burn DVDs at 16x, CD-Rs at 32x and CD-RWs at 24x.

Of course, it’s near $400 price tag doesn’t make this product exactly budget-friendly.

Onkyo, a popular gadget maker, has finally introduced its own Blu-ray Player called DV-BD606. Designed to give an exceptional audio and video quality, Onkyo DV-BD606 Blu-ray Player provides full 1080p playback including 24fps “film mode”.

Onkyo DV-BD606 Blu-ray Player supports Deep Color via HDMI, Dolby TrueHD as well as DTS-HD Master Audio formats like direct bitstream output via HDMI or 7.1-channel audio output.

Priced at £399.99, the new Onkyo DV-BD606 Blu-ray Player incorporates BonusView features like picture-in-picture functionality. It does a fine job in upscaling your existing DVD collection apart from playing audio CDs in an exceptional way.

Recently, Samsung, a world-class electronic brand, came up with its new 1080p SyncMaster 2494HS LCD TV. Sporting a 23.6-inch LCD monitor, this new product from Samsung comes with an HDMI port.

Designed to deliver 1920 x 1080 pixel resolution and 300- cd/m2 brightness, the new Samsung 1080p SyncMaster 2494HS LCD TV is just perfect for PC. It provides a vertical viewing angle of 160 degrees/ 170 degrees left and right.

Samsung 1080p SyncMaster 2494HS LCD TV comes fitted with integrated stereo speakers of 3W each. It also features DVI/ VGA/ HDMI inputs. Providing you with a fast 5 ms response time, this LCD TV comes with 200 x 100mm VESA mount support.

Kenwood CR-iP500: Radio with iPod Dock

Wednesday 26 November 2008 @ 8:29 pm

Kenwood has presented yet another iPod dock, but this time it is different because it has additional specs that make it worth the $270.

The CR-iP500 can playback MP3 and WMA files thanks to the CD player, or alternatively you can use the USB2.0 connection. It also has an iPod dock with controls located on the Kenwood device. The other alternative to listen to audio is the FM tuner, which is able to save 30 station presets. But the most important functionality, is the ability to rip audio CDs into a USB flash drive in MP3 format, and you can even pick the sample rate that goes from the low 96kbps to the high 256kbps.

The sound comes from the 3.15-inch speakers with 5W of “sound power”.

Logitech’s new Harmony universal remotes probably aren’t going to stop any fights, but according to their studies recently released to promote the product, they may actually be fight starters.

According to Logitech, 91% of families fight over the remote control for the television, and of that 91%, 72% of people have argued over the remote, 12% have thrown it, and 7% have gotten into a legit physical fight over it. Sounds crazy?

Well, also according to Logitech families will watch on average 3-hours of TV this upcoming Christmas so why don’t you observe your families behavior this holiday, maybe Logitech’s findings are more correct than they come off to be.

Yamaha DVX-1000: 2.1 Home Cinema System

Tuesday 25 November 2008 @ 8:16 pm

If a home cinema system is on your Christmas list but you only have space on your living room for a 2.1 system, take a look at the Yamaha DVX-1000.

This Yamaha model consists of two 90W speakers + 1 big subwoofer, and received a good rating of 90% at RegisterHardware. The price tag is pretty high £1,000 (close to $1,500) but taking in consideration its performance, it is well worth the money.

Thanks to a Yamaha technology named Air Surround Xtreme, the DVX-1000 is able to provide sound quality similar to a 7.1 system.

The unit can handle DivX and DivX Ultra video, and JPEG snaps on disc or USB stick. Connections at the rear of the head unit include an HDMI interface, Scart, optical digital in, component- and composite-video out, s-video out, analogue (aux) input and line out.
